MPH Firmware Launcher v1.0 for the PSP

Posted Sep 12, 2005 at 4:20PM EST by QJ Staff

Listed in: Hacks & Exploits, Homebrew Applications Tags: psp exploits, psp hacks
Ó

Psp_frontb

MPH has created a firmware launcher that will launch a PSP firmware from the memory stick. This doesn?t have any solid application yet, but it is another step towards understanding the PSP?s firmware. Here is what he had to say:

-> Use with precaution, i am not responsable for possible damage <-

MPH Firmware Launcher v1.0
---------------------------------

Allows to launch a firmware from the memory stick.

The firmware must be in file format and not in eboot.pbp format, for convert a firmware eboot.pbp in file, use the psardump01 tool [here].

Installation :
- For 1.00 firmware : copy MPHFL (in 1.00 folder) to PSP/GAME folder of your memory stick
- For 1.50 firmware : copy MPHFL and MPHFL% (in 1.50 folder) to PSP/GAME of your memory stick

Create a F0 and F1 folder in root of memory stick, put files of flash0 (data, dic, font, kd et vsh) in F0 and put files of flash1 (dic, registry et vsh) in F1.

Run MPH Firmware Launcher.

Limitation :
He is not finished, bugs with somes prx loading.

For the moment, i have test with a 1.50 psp to load 1.00 firmware, it works but the version showed in the VSHELL still 1.50 and the psp crashes if i run an application. Don't work for the 2.00 firmware because he uses a different encryption system. You can download 1.00 firmware in good format here : http://www.chez.com/mph/
